Actually actually SD has a clock spectrum, so it is indeed possible to raise the clock speed (aka overclock). Has to be done on the host though.

edit: https://www.sdcard.org/downloads/pls/part1_410.pdf, page 61.

Only by replacing the components, and that wouldn't be overclocking as overclocking requires you to run the existing hardware at faster speeds... Would be like saying i'm going to overclock my pc by replacing the CPU...

While I haven't looked into the schematics I don't believe the SD clock gets generated purely in hardware on the 3DS, especially as the SD spec demands a slow clock for init and only allows it to be increased after the capabilities of host and clients had been negotiated.

Shouldn't be worth the hassle to try it anyway, though.
